Review Comment:
   Potential edge case: for category radius axes, computing boundaries via 
radiusAxis.scale.getExtent plus radiusAxis.dataToCoord may shift min/max line 
inward because onBand affects dataToCoord. Could we consider using 
radiusAxis.getExtent boundaries directly, or handling onBand explicitly, so 
axisLine.showMinLine/showMaxLine stays aligned with axis boundaries?
